summaryrefslogtreecommitdiff
path: root/packages/integrations/vercel/test
diff options
context:
space:
mode:
Diffstat (limited to 'packages/integrations/vercel/test')
-rw-r--r--packages/integrations/vercel/test/edge-middleware.test.js12
-rw-r--r--packages/integrations/vercel/test/hosted/hosted.test.js3
-rw-r--r--packages/integrations/vercel/test/isr.test.js2
-rw-r--r--packages/integrations/vercel/test/max-duration.test.js2
-rw-r--r--packages/integrations/vercel/test/redirects.test.js2
-rw-r--r--packages/integrations/vercel/test/server-islands.test.js2
-rw-r--r--packages/integrations/vercel/test/serverless-prerender.test.js6
-rw-r--r--packages/integrations/vercel/test/serverless-with-dynamic-routes.test.js4
-rw-r--r--packages/integrations/vercel/test/split.test.js2
-rw-r--r--packages/integrations/vercel/test/streaming.test.js2
10 files changed, 19 insertions, 18 deletions
diff --git a/packages/integrations/vercel/test/edge-middleware.test.js b/packages/integrations/vercel/test/edge-middleware.test.js
index 9ae583a11..4e67433d0 100644
--- a/packages/integrations/vercel/test/edge-middleware.test.js
+++ b/packages/integrations/vercel/test/edge-middleware.test.js
@@ -14,7 +14,7 @@ describe('Vercel edge middleware', () => {
it('an edge function is created', async () => {
const contents = await build.readFile(
- '../.vercel/output/functions/_middleware.func/.vc-config.json',
+ '../.vercel/output/functions/_middleware.func/.vc-config.json'
);
const contentsJSON = JSON.parse(contents);
assert.equal(contentsJSON.runtime, 'edge');
@@ -26,14 +26,14 @@ describe('Vercel edge middleware', () => {
const { routes } = JSON.parse(contents);
assert.equal(
routes.some((route) => route.dest === '_middleware'),
- true,
+ true
);
});
it('edge sets Set-Cookie headers', async () => {
- let entry = new URL(
+ const entry = new URL(
'../.vercel/output/functions/_middleware.func/middleware.mjs',
- build.config.outDir,
+ build.config.outDir
);
const module = await import(entry);
const request = new Request('http://example.com/foo');
@@ -50,7 +50,7 @@ describe('Vercel edge middleware', () => {
await fixture.build();
const contents = await fixture.readFile(
// this is abysmal...
- '../.vercel/output/functions/render.func/www/withastro/astro/packages/integrations/vercel/test/fixtures/middleware-with-edge-file/dist/middleware.mjs',
+ '../.vercel/output/functions/render.func/www/withastro/astro/packages/integrations/vercel/test/fixtures/middleware-with-edge-file/dist/middleware.mjs'
);
console.log(contents);
// assert.equal(contents.includes('title:')).to.be.true;
@@ -66,7 +66,7 @@ describe('Vercel edge middleware', () => {
await fixture.build();
const contents = await fixture.readFile(
// this is abysmal...
- '../.vercel/output/functions/render.func/www/withastro/astro/packages/integrations/vercel/test/fixtures/middleware-without-edge-file/dist/middleware.mjs',
+ '../.vercel/output/functions/render.func/www/withastro/astro/packages/integrations/vercel/test/fixtures/middleware-without-edge-file/dist/middleware.mjs'
);
console.log(contents);
// assert.equal(contents.includes('title:')).to.be.false;
diff --git a/packages/integrations/vercel/test/hosted/hosted.test.js b/packages/integrations/vercel/test/hosted/hosted.test.js
index e090188a7..d7c2ece20 100644
--- a/packages/integrations/vercel/test/hosted/hosted.test.js
+++ b/packages/integrations/vercel/test/hosted/hosted.test.js
@@ -6,7 +6,8 @@ const VERCEL_TEST_URL = 'https://astro-vercel-image-test.vercel.app';
describe('Hosted Vercel Tests', () => {
it('Image endpoint works', async () => {
const image = await fetch(
- VERCEL_TEST_URL + '/_image?href=%2F_astro%2Fpenguin.e9c64733.png&w=300&f=webp',
+ // biome-ignore lint/style/useTemplate: <explanation>
+ VERCEL_TEST_URL + '/_image?href=%2F_astro%2Fpenguin.e9c64733.png&w=300&f=webp'
);
assert.equal(image.status, 200);
diff --git a/packages/integrations/vercel/test/isr.test.js b/packages/integrations/vercel/test/isr.test.js
index fb957aa78..a8df2c0ef 100644
--- a/packages/integrations/vercel/test/isr.test.js
+++ b/packages/integrations/vercel/test/isr.test.js
@@ -15,7 +15,7 @@ describe('ISR', () => {
it('generates expected prerender config', async () => {
const vcConfig = JSON.parse(
- await fixture.readFile('../.vercel/output/functions/_isr.prerender-config.json'),
+ await fixture.readFile('../.vercel/output/functions/_isr.prerender-config.json')
);
assert.deepEqual(vcConfig, {
expiration: 120,
diff --git a/packages/integrations/vercel/test/max-duration.test.js b/packages/integrations/vercel/test/max-duration.test.js
index d5e26fc1a..2a7698663 100644
--- a/packages/integrations/vercel/test/max-duration.test.js
+++ b/packages/integrations/vercel/test/max-duration.test.js
@@ -15,7 +15,7 @@ describe('maxDuration', () => {
it('makes it to vercel function configuration', async () => {
const vcConfig = JSON.parse(
- await fixture.readFile('../.vercel/output/functions/_render.func/.vc-config.json'),
+ await fixture.readFile('../.vercel/output/functions/_render.func/.vc-config.json')
);
assert.equal(vcConfig.maxDuration, 60);
});
diff --git a/packages/integrations/vercel/test/redirects.test.js b/packages/integrations/vercel/test/redirects.test.js
index 9d4f9499e..57de308e2 100644
--- a/packages/integrations/vercel/test/redirects.test.js
+++ b/packages/integrations/vercel/test/redirects.test.js
@@ -77,7 +77,7 @@ describe('Redirects', () => {
const config = await getConfig();
assert.equal(
config.routes.find((r) => r.src === '/'),
- undefined,
+ undefined
);
});
});
diff --git a/packages/integrations/vercel/test/server-islands.test.js b/packages/integrations/vercel/test/server-islands.test.js
index 0306bb8b2..f4f176707 100644
--- a/packages/integrations/vercel/test/server-islands.test.js
+++ b/packages/integrations/vercel/test/server-islands.test.js
@@ -16,7 +16,7 @@ describe('Server Islands', () => {
it('server islands route is in the config', async () => {
const config = JSON.parse(await fixture.readFile('../.vercel/output/config.json'));
let found = null;
- for (let route of config.routes) {
+ for (const route of config.routes) {
if (route.src?.includes('_server-islands')) {
found = route;
break;
diff --git a/packages/integrations/vercel/test/serverless-prerender.test.js b/packages/integrations/vercel/test/serverless-prerender.test.js
index 61e239300..5b75418c9 100644
--- a/packages/integrations/vercel/test/serverless-prerender.test.js
+++ b/packages/integrations/vercel/test/serverless-prerender.test.js
@@ -20,7 +20,7 @@ describe('Serverless prerender', () => {
it('outDir is tree-shaken if not needed', async () => {
const [file] = await fixture.glob(
- '../.vercel/output/functions/_render.func/packages/integrations/vercel/test/fixtures/serverless-prerender/.vercel/output/_functions/pages/_image.astro.mjs',
+ '../.vercel/output/functions/_render.func/packages/integrations/vercel/test/fixtures/serverless-prerender/.vercel/output/_functions/pages/_image.astro.mjs'
);
const contents = await fixture.readFile(file);
assert.ok(!contents.includes('const outDir ='), "outDir is tree-shaken if it's not imported");
@@ -30,8 +30,8 @@ describe('Serverless prerender', () => {
it.skip('includeFiles work', async () => {
assert.ok(
await fixture.readFile(
- '../.vercel/output/functions/render.func/packages/integrations/vercel/test/fixtures/serverless-prerender/dist/middleware.mjs',
- ),
+ '../.vercel/output/functions/render.func/packages/integrations/vercel/test/fixtures/serverless-prerender/dist/middleware.mjs'
+ )
);
});
});
diff --git a/packages/integrations/vercel/test/serverless-with-dynamic-routes.test.js b/packages/integrations/vercel/test/serverless-with-dynamic-routes.test.js
index 3f9613834..0967f864b 100644
--- a/packages/integrations/vercel/test/serverless-with-dynamic-routes.test.js
+++ b/packages/integrations/vercel/test/serverless-with-dynamic-routes.test.js
@@ -18,10 +18,10 @@ describe('Serverless with dynamic routes', () => {
it('build successful', async () => {
assert.ok(await fixture.readFile('../.vercel/output/static/index.html'));
assert.ok(
- await fixture.readFile('../.vercel/output/functions/[id]/index.astro.func/.vc-config.json'),
+ await fixture.readFile('../.vercel/output/functions/[id]/index.astro.func/.vc-config.json')
);
assert.ok(
- await fixture.readFile('../.vercel/output/functions/api/[id].js.func/.vc-config.json'),
+ await fixture.readFile('../.vercel/output/functions/api/[id].js.func/.vc-config.json')
);
});
});
diff --git a/packages/integrations/vercel/test/split.test.js b/packages/integrations/vercel/test/split.test.js
index 4105db7fc..e64a4dc60 100644
--- a/packages/integrations/vercel/test/split.test.js
+++ b/packages/integrations/vercel/test/split.test.js
@@ -26,7 +26,7 @@ describe('build: split', () => {
assert.equal(config.routes.length, 5);
assert.equal(
config.routes.some((route) => route.dest === 'prerender.astro'),
- false,
+ false
);
});
});
diff --git a/packages/integrations/vercel/test/streaming.test.js b/packages/integrations/vercel/test/streaming.test.js
index 1e4b0f111..a0172a7e6 100644
--- a/packages/integrations/vercel/test/streaming.test.js
+++ b/packages/integrations/vercel/test/streaming.test.js
@@ -15,7 +15,7 @@ describe('streaming', () => {
it('makes it to vercel function configuration', async () => {
const vcConfig = JSON.parse(
- await fixture.readFile('../.vercel/output/functions/_render.func/.vc-config.json'),
+ await fixture.readFile('../.vercel/output/functions/_render.func/.vc-config.json')
);
assert.equal(vcConfig.supportsResponseStreaming, true);
});